Credit Card Crackdown

These days, when credit crisis hits cardholders, no one is fully protected against interest hikes and exorbitant fees on their cards unless they have excellent credit history. Banks and card companies face an ever-increasing number of credit card delinquencies, and that's the reason why they're becoming more aggressive. They need to recoup their losses, and it doesn't really matter whether you are a diligent customer who pays credit bills on time, or you're still trying to kick the habit of being late with your credit card payments. They need to gain profits, and they are raising credit card fees and rates to squeeze more revenue out of their client's accounts.

Credit Card Marketing April 08, 2008

Banks and card companies become more aggressive when it comes to the advertising of credit products. Moreover, college students meet face to face with loan sharks at college campuses. Interestingly, now creditors are getting more creative by offering credit card applications with various free gifts like pizzas, candies, not to mention traditional T-shirts.

According to the research, more than 75% of college students say plastics have been offered to them through the tables set near campuses. Free beverages or T-shirts serve as an incentive to sign up for a card. Just like companies recruit and hire the most talented students, lenders search for potential clients at college campuses to make them stay loyal with some particular company.
